返回

解锁智能聊天机器人潜力:Azure OpenAI Embedding揭秘

后端

Azure OpenAI Embedding:开启智能聊天机器人的新时代

一、Azure OpenAI Embedding 的强大功能

1. 自然语言处理技术:打造流畅对话

Azure OpenAI Embedding 采用尖端的自然语言处理技术,赋予聊天机器人理解自然语言并做出智能回应的能力。它能识别用户的意图,基于语境提供相关信息,让对话如同人类之间的交流般自然。

2. 文本嵌入:深刻语义理解

Azure OpenAI Embedding 将文本转换成向量形式,称为文本嵌入。这种向量形式帮助聊天机器人领会文本的语义含义,从而做出更精准的回答。同时,文本嵌入还可用于计算语义相似度,让聊天机器人找出语义相关的文档或文本。

3. GPT-3 知识宝库:触手可及的信息海洋

Azure OpenAI Embedding 与 GPT-3 强强联手,为聊天机器人提供了庞大的知识库,涵盖历史、科学、哲学、艺术等各个领域。聊天机器人能利用 GPT-3 的知识储备解答用户问题,生成有见地的回复。

4. 无缝集成:轻松构建聊天机器人

Azure OpenAI Embedding 可与其他 Azure 服务无缝集成,如 Azure Functions 和 Azure Logic Apps。这种无缝集成让开发者能快速、轻松地构建聊天机器人,无需复杂的编码和配置。

二、释放 Azure OpenAI Embedding 的力量

1. 创建 Azure OpenAI 服务实例

首先,通过 Azure 门户或 Azure CLI 创建 Azure OpenAI 服务实例。选择合适的定价层和区域。

2. 获取访问密钥

创建实例后,获取访问密钥,用于授权您访问 Azure OpenAI 服务。

3. 准备文本数据

准备文本数据来训练您的聊天机器人。数据形式不限,如新闻、博客文章、聊天记录等。确保数据干净,无错误或重复。

4. 训练聊天机器人

使用 Azure OpenAI 服务训练您的聊天机器人。训练时间视数据量和模型复杂性而异,一般为几分钟至几小时。

5. 部署聊天机器人

训练完成后,将聊天机器人部署到生产环境中。您可以使用 Azure Functions、Azure Logic Apps 或其他平台进行部署。

三、解锁无限可能

Azure OpenAI Embedding 为智能聊天机器人开启了新篇章,让快速构建成为可能。利用其强大功能,您可以打造自己的智能聊天机器人,应用于客户服务、医疗、教育等各个场景。踏上智能聊天机器人之旅,释放无限可能,让它们成为您业务的强大助手。

常见问题解答

1. Azure OpenAI Embedding 和 ChatGPT 有什么区别?

Azure OpenAI Embedding 是 Azure 云平台上的一项服务,提供自然语言处理和文本嵌入功能,而 ChatGPT 是 OpenAI 开发的特定大型语言模型。

2. Azure OpenAI Embedding 的定价如何?

Azure OpenAI Embedding 的定价基于使用量和所选的定价层。查看 Azure 定价页面了解更多详情。

3. 我需要编程技能才能使用 Azure OpenAI Embedding 吗?

不,Azure OpenAI Embedding 提供了用户友好的界面和与其他 Azure 服务的无缝集成,让您无需编程技能也能构建聊天机器人。

4. Azure OpenAI Embedding 是否安全?

是的,Azure OpenAI Embedding 遵循 Microsoft 严格的安全标准和法规遵从性。

5. 我可以在哪里获得 Azure OpenAI Embedding 的支持?

您可以通过 Azure 文档、社区论坛和 Microsoft 支持团队获得 Azure OpenAI Embedding 的支持。